Biography
Chauncey Alexander Hollis Jr., born May 21, 1987 is a record producer, rapper, singer and songwriter from Fontana, California. In May 2011, Hollis had signed a 2-year deal with [a=Kanye West]'s [l=Getting Out Our Dreams] production branch. He produced singles such as "Niggas in Paris" by [a=Jay-Z] and Kanye West, "Trophies" by [a=Drake] and the Grammy-winning "Racks in the Middle" by [a=Nipsey Hussle] featuring [a=Roddy Ricch]. The song won Best Rap Performance at the 2020 Grammy Awards. In December 2012, it was revealed he had signed a recording contract with [l=Interscope Records], and subsequently founded his own record label imprint, [l=Hits Since 87].
